Head to head by decade
| Decade | Ecuador | Portugal |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 77.4% | 99.0% | 21.6% | Portugal |
| 1990s | 80.4% | 99.2% | 18.8% | Portugal |
| 2000s | 86.8% | 99.2% | 12.4% | Portugal |
| 2010s | 94.8% | 99.3% | 4.6% | Portugal |
| 2020s | 99.1% | 99.5% | 0.4% | Portugal |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
